RPC over HTTP -- Outlook over Internet option not showing

C

Craig

I have a user running Outlook 2003 SP2 on Windows XP SP2. All other
users running this configuration have a checkbox for "Outlook over the
Internet" on their Connections tab...this user does not. In all of
the reading I have done it mentions that you must have Outlook 2003
and XP SP1 for this option to be enabled. Someone else configured his
laptop for him so I am not sure if some sort of group policy is being
applied to block access to this.

Any ideas on where I can look??

A little confused, but if the OS is Windows XP (SP1), then they need to have
KB 331320. Ideally, I tell all my customers the base should be Windows XP
(SP2) since it saves them from tracking down the extra update.

In any event, can you check to see if EnableRPCTunnelingUI registry key
exists?

Location:

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office\11.0\Outlook\RPC

and/or

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Office\11.0\Outlook\RPC

If EnableRPCTunnelingUI doesn't exists or set to 1, you should get the UI.
Other accepted values are 0 (Hidden), 2 (enable on/off but no config), 3
(enable config UI when settings are pre-deployed), and 4 (Disable but show
all config UI).

/SM

PS - Don't forget to double check the mail account configuration. Some
folks are cute where they setup for POP3/IMAP and throw you for a loop when
you think are a dealing with an Exchange mail profile.
